Proper notice procedures, including the notification of all adjoining property owners, has been shown by the applicant. 2. The required hardship or practical difficulty has been established. 3. Granting such relief will not cause substantial detriment to the public welfare and will not substantially impair the intent and purpose of the Zoning Resolutions and the zoning maps.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Board of Adjustment that an 18.5 foot south side yard setback variance shall be granted for an addition to a single - family residence, as shown on the attached plans (Exhibits " B ", "C ", and "D "), due to the narrowness of property resulting in peculiar practical difficulties. WARNING: Any violation of the terms of this resolution may result in rehearing and possible revocation. The Resolution was adopted by vote of the Board of Adjustment of the County of Pitkin, State of Colorado. I I ,I I r P. e9 }I 3000 5 MINUTES Meeting of the Pitkin County Board of Adjustment December 7. 2010 Members Present: Jamie Brewster- McLeod and Rick Head, Co- chairs Bob Throm, Patrick McAllister Members Absent: Jim Rifkin Staff: Joanna S. Schaffner, Zoning Officer and acting secretary Brewster- McLeod opened the meeting at 5:40 pm. There is no tape recording of this meeting. Minutes are based on notes taken at the meeting. CASELOAD: Case # 10 -2010 GSS Properties, LLC 7989 Highway 133 Architect, George Winne, and GSS Properties tenant, Oak Applegate, were present to request an 18'5' south side yard setback variance to construct an addition to a single - family residence. The property contains 5.4 acres, is located in the RS -30 zone district. and requires a 30 foot side yard setback. The Affidavit of Posting was submitted. There were no members of the public present to comment on this application. Winne explained the desire for increased living area in this small residence. The lot is long and narrow, with steep slopes at either end, separated by a small flat bench. The existing and proposed developments are located on this bench. The proposed addition has been located in the side yard setback to avoid development in the front yard, where the septic system and large trees limit development potential. Large trees in the rear yard could have been at risk. The proposed location is the most logical given the floorplan of the existing house. Winne mentioned that there was no objection from the neighbor to the south, whose residence is located up the hill behind the applicant house. He also stated that an application has been submitted to the Community Development Department for Site Plan / Activity Envelope review, but has not yet received a decision/determination. Head motioned to approve the variance based on the narrowness of the property resulting in peculiar practical hardships. Throm seconded the motion. The motion passed 3 to 1, with Brewster - McLeod dissenting. MINUTES: Head made a motion to approve the minutes from the October 15, 2010 meeting and the motion was seconded by Brewster- McLeod. The motion was approved by 4 -0. There being no further business, the meeting was adjourned. Respectfully submitted. The new addition will include a 453 square foot Living/Dining room addition on the ground floor and a 420 square foot storage room basement. The total addition will consist of 873 square foot. The addition will be constructed on the south side of the existing residence, and be finished with exterior materials to match the existing residence. To the best of our knowledge, after requesting information from the County, there was no information on file regarding previous approvals, permits, or drawings for this property. Due to this situation, it was determined that an 'Activity Envelope & Site Plan Approval' would be required prior to submitting for a building permit. That application has been submitted to the Planning Department and is presently under review. We are also required to submit for a `Setback Variance Approval', as this addition extends beyond the minimum side setback. The existing residence is occupied by a family of five (2 parents & 3 small children), of which the husband is the ranch manager for the owner of the property, GSS Properties, LLC. This residence has the appropriate number of bedrooms & bathrooms, but the Living room & eat -in Kitchen, located on the south side of the residence, is too small for the family's daily activities. The owner has agreed to construct an addition to provide the family with a separate dining area & an enlarged living room. After reviewing this design criteria and considering the existing room layout & site conditions, the most appropriate location for the addition is on the south side of the existing residence. A separate Dining area is proposed to the south of the existing kitchen, and the existing Living area would be enlarged to the south. The addition is to be constructed as a simple rectangular box (15' x 28') with a new gable roof that is an extension of the existing roof. This design solution resulted in building the addition over the side setback. This property is zoned RS-30 with side setbacks of 30 feet. We are proposing a new south side setback of 15.0 feet for the main structure and 11.5 feet for the cantilevered fireplace /log storage section. The shape of this property is unusual in that the proportions of width -to -depth are quite extreme, 120' wide by 1968' deep. When the 2 side setbacks of 30 feet each are considered, the buildable width of the property is reduced by half to approximately 60 feet. The existing residence is 58 feet wide and centered in the lot width, therefore eliminating any opportunity to build on the sides of the residence. 2. Although there is buildable area on the east side of the residence (front) towards Highway 133, the new spaces are best suited along the south side: the dining room off the kitchen, and the extension of the living area to adjoin the new dining room. 3. An addition on the east side of the residence would require the elimination of the primary entrance to the existing residence, requiring the family to enter the home through the garage or from an existing exterior door on the southwest comer (back door). By placing the addition on the south side, the existing entrance to the residence and access to all the interior rooms would not be affected. The daily activities of the family could continue during construction, and not be adversely affected. 4. If the addition were constructed on the east side, the existing sewer line (from house to septic tank) would have to be removed and relocated, and the family would have to relocate for a period of time while the basement construction and revisions to this utility were being completed. This would also create an additional expense for the project that the owner wants to avoid. 5. An addition on the east side would adversely affect the existing landscaping. There are several large mature pine trees in front of the residence that would have to be removed due to the excavation for the basement and relocation of utilities. Again, this would add further expenses to the project & the owner wants to leave the existing landscaping intact. An addition on the south side does not affect any of the existing landscaping, particularly the mature trees on the site. 6. By constructing the addition on the south side, the existing exterior wall that would be removed is a non - bearing wall that would not affect the structural integrity of the roof framing. If the addition is placed on the east side, a portion of the existing east exterior wall would be removed. This wall is a bearing wall for the existing roof framing and would require temporary support during construction and new structural beams and columns to support the existing roof for the new interior opening created by the addition.
